South Atlantic Black Sea Bass Recreational Season Starts April 1, 2018

Key Message:

The 2018-2019 recreational fishing season for black sea bass in federal waters of the South Atlantic, south of 35°15.9′ N. latitude (Cape Hatteras, North Carolina), will start on April 1, 2018, and end at 12:01 a.m., local time, on April 1, 2019.  Estimates indicate recreational landings for the 2018-2019 fishing year will be below the 2018-2019 recreational catch limit.  Therefore, black sea bass will be open for the entire 2018-2019 recreational fishing year.

Why This Announcement is Happening:

  • This announcement is in compliance with the final rule for Regulatory Amendment 14 to the Fishery Management Plan for the Snapper-Grouper Fishery of the South Atlantic Region, which published on November 7, 2014 (79 FR 66316).
  • NOAA Fisheries projects that the 2018-2019 recreational catch limit of 1,001,177 pounds whole weight will not be met as recreational landings in the past three fishing years were substantially below this value.
